WebFacial redness (erythema) is caused by cutaneous blood vessel dilation and increased blood flow to the skin. It’s more noticeable in people with fair skin. -Ddx can be categorized according to the cause of facial redness: primary skin diseases, external insults, and systemic illness. WebMar 15, 2010 · Although most generalized rashes are pink or red, lichen planus is characterized by violaceous lesions, and secondary syphilis by red-brown lesions. In … WebWhat is intertrigo?. Intertrigo describes a rash in the flexures, such as behind the ears, in the folds of the neck, under the arms, under a protruding abdomen, in the groin, between the buttocks, in the finger webs, or in the toe spaces.Although intertrigo can affect only one skin fold, intertrigo commonly involves multiple sites.
